What happened

Anthropic says it has blocked efforts to use its artificial intelligence models to carry out cyber attacks and research which could have led to the creation of biological weapons.

Terror groups, China turn to off-the-shelf AI to make weapons smarter

Anthropic revealed state actors used AI for weapons development and intelligence. A China-based actor built electronic warfare software targeting Taiwan's defenses. Yemen-based actors developed guided rockets and ballistic missiles using AI.
